When looking for a diamond wedding ring, it is important to consider the 4 Cs: carat, clarity, color, and cut. Carat refers to the weight of the diamond, while clarity refers to the presence of flaws or inclusions. Color ranges from clear to yellow or brown, with clear being the most valuable. Cut refers to the shape and angles of the diamond, which affect its brilliance and fire.
If you are looking for a diamond wedding ring, there are many options available. You can choose from a variety of styles, such as solitaire, halo, or three-stone. You can also choose from different metals, such as platinum, gold, or white gold. Some diamond wedding rings even have additional diamonds or gemstones for added sparkle and beauty.
